This weekend, New Balance gave fans a highly anticipated sneak peek at the new design for the official 2014 runDisney shoe. The 2013 design, which featured Mickey (men’s) and Minnie (women’s), was officially retired during the Wine and Dine Half Marathon Weekend. The new design will feature Sorcerer Mickey (men’s) and Pink Minnie (women’s). Although New Balance will not fully unveil the new shoe until the Health and Fitness Expo during the Walt Disney World Marathon Weekend in January, they did offers eager followers enough of a teaser glimpse at their new design. It looks as though the men’s shoe will be red and feature Sorcerer Mickey on the back. The women’s shoe appears to be a bright pink and has pink Minnie on the back. New Balance also unveiled the addition of runDisney shoes for kids. The New Balance runDisney shoes are only available at Health and Fitness Expos during runDisney event weekends. It has not been revealed if there will be any changes in price for the 2014 shoes or what the cost might be for the kids’ shoes. The price for the runDisney shoes in 2013 was around $125.
In addition to the 2014 shoe design, runDisney also announced the addition of other shoe accessories that devoted runners can purchase to customize their shoes and commemorate their endurance accomplishments. Race specific shoe inserts, shoe box sticker to record race date and finish time, and a lace keeper type decoration have all been designed to allow runners to celebrate their accomplishments long after they have crossed the finish line. At all of the runDisney events throughout the year, these packages will be available for purchase and runners can collect these little extras as they rack up their runDisney miles.
